Sky Posted January 28, 2020 Author Share Posted January 28, 2020 Some fun character quirks/traits that I came up with/took from other fictional characters: -stuttering when nervous -scratching a certain place on their body (like their neck or head) when faced with a problem to solve -really, really bad at lying -bites fingernails all the time -has random spurts of energy for absolutely no reason -hates to fight unlike every main character ever and just hides out when there's some action going on -when fighting, time seems to go by really fast and everything is sort of a blur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Sky Posted January 28, 2020 Author Share Posted January 28, 2020 Character ideas: -approximately 30 yr old (or equivalent) mom with a ton of kids who joins protagonist's group just so she can get away from her annoying children -person with unnaturally bad luck but they're not really affected by it (e.g. cars crash around them, but don't get in their way; it starts raining wherever they go, but only 2 minutes after they've left; their umbrellas always break but someone always has an extra) -person with unnaturally bad luck who just doesn't care and is used to it (e.g. it rains all the time but only where they are, they always carry an umbrella on them; their pens run out of ink very fast, but they have like 10 extras with them at all times) -a gang of orphans who live without adult supervision but do pretty okay for themselves -a cat who sits on stuff all the time and eventually the protag figures out that the cat always sits on stuff that the protag will need within the hour (e.g. cat sits on a book, half an hour later the protag goes to read it and find important information relevant to their quest within it) 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Sky Posted February 6, 2020 Author Share Posted February 6, 2020 story idea: In a fantasy world, two sixteen-or-so-year-olds are in an arranged marriage. They aren't married yet, but they'll have to marry eachother when they each turn 17... which isn't in very long. They absolutely *hate* eachother. Thus, they decide to go on a quest to do a heroic thing that will make them really popular and, depending on the reason given for the arrangement, will make it so the arranged marriage is not needed anymore. The pair begrudgingly work together to reach their goal. One (or both) of them doesn't care about the heroic thing; for example, if the heroic thing is to get rid of an evil queen and save others from her minions on the way, then one of the pair doesn't really care about the people they save, just the fact that soon they'll get out of the marriage. However, by the end, they are an actual good person and are glad they saved all those people. Extra twist if wanted: throughout the story the pair begins to like eachother and by the end they're in love, despite having hated eachother at first. TheCrazyDragonLady Posted February 7, 2020 Share Posted February 7, 2020 Story prompt I wrote for a family member You feel the vibrations from the music pulsing through the floor and up your legs, encouraging your body to move. You lower your torso to your feet, your back curving like a cats as you slowly pull yourself up, your fingertips brushing against your legs Your hands slide along your body, around your hips, up your midsection, over your arms and are raised above your head You sway to the beat of the music, the people around you each dancing in their own unique way. The intoxicating smell of sweat and perfume fills your nostrils as you take a deep breath, your lungs already starting to give in to your exhaustion and asthma. You can't stop, even for a moment though. None of you can. You are dancing for your lives.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
